Addition big decimal
WebSep 11, 2024 · BigDecimal a = new BigDecimal ("12345.12345"); BigDecimal b = new BigDecimal ("23456.23456"); BigDecimal c = a.multiply (b); System.out.println ("c=" + c); Now the console output is the following: Copy code snippet c=289570111.3153564320 WebThe java.math.BigDecimal.divide () method is used to add the BigDecimal object . Syntax BigDecimal obj1ofBigDecimal=obj1ofBigDecimal.divide (obj2ofBigDecimal); Ex: …
Addition big decimal
Did you know?
WebJava BigDecimal intValue() method. The hashCode() method of java BigDecimal class is used to Convert a BigDecimal to an int type value. Note: This conversion can lose information about the overall magnitude and precision of this BigDecimal value as well as return a result with the opposite sign. WebSep 2, 2024 · BigDecimal is immutable, a new object will be generated every time the four operations are performed, so remember to save the value after the operation when doing addition, subtraction ...
WebBigDecimal is immutable. Every operation returns a new instance containing the result of the operation: BigDecimal sum = x.add(y); If you want x to change, you thus have to do. … WebJul 4, 2013 · You're trying to call the decimal module directly, instead use decimal.Decimal.decimal is a module object which contains attributes like Decimal, 'DefaultContext' etc, to access these attributes use the dot notation (decimal.attr_name). >>> import decimal >>> decimal.Decimal('1.234') Decimal('1.234') >>> …
WebThe BigDecimal class provides operations for arithmetic, scale manipulation, rounding, comparison, hashing, and format conversion. The toString () method provides a … WebMay 27, 2024 · The java.math.BigDecimal .subtract (BigDecimal val) is used to calculate the Arithmetic difference of two BigDecimals. This method is used to find the arithmetic difference of large numbers without compromising with the precision of the result. This method performs an operation upon the current BigDecimal by which this method is …
WebDivision is a bit more complicated than the other arithmetic operations, for instance consider the below example: BigDecimal a = new BigDecimal ("5"); BigDecimal b = new BigDecimal ("7"); BigDecimal result = a.divide (b); System.out.println (result); We would expect this to give something similar to : 0.7142857142857143, but we would get:
WebJul 30, 2024 · Math operations for BigDecimal in Java Java 8 Object Oriented Programming Programming Let us apply the following operations on BigDecimal using the in-built methods in Java − Addition: add () method Subtraction: subtract () method Multiplication: multiply () method Division: divide () method Let us create three BigInteger … me5024 spec sheetme5024 storage arrayWebApr 14, 2024 · Managing large numbers using JS Big Decimal. JS Big Decimal is another JavaScript library you can use to work with large numbers. Unlike its counterparts above, JS Big Decimal has a small bundle size and comes with a limited set of features. ... JS Big Decimal has functions for performing basic mathematical operations such as addition ... me 4 year planWebTo add decimals, follow these steps: Write down the numbers, one under the other, with the decimal points lined up Put in zeros so the numbers have the same length ( see below … me54 tcode in sapWeb对于a BigDecimal 诸如42.7之类的数字,我如何将其拆开以获取整数部分(42)和小数分数部分(0.7)??我想将两个作为BigDecimal对象检索.但是我会从中拿走我可以得到的BigDecimal对象.解决方案 tl; dr myBigDecimal.divideAndRemainder( BigD me 5 1 n breakdown gfebs me createWebJun 27, 2024 · BigDecimal represents an immutable arbitrary-precision signed decimal number. It consists of two parts: Unscaled value – an arbitrary precision integer Scale – … me 502 wichita stateWebDec 4, 2009 · BigDecimal A = new BigDecimal ("10000000000"); BigDecimal B = new BigDecimal ("20000000000"); BigDecimal C = new BigDecimal ("30000000000"); BigDecimal resultSum = (A).add (B).add (C); System.out.println ("A+B+C= " + … me50 boss